[quote=Anonymous]How wide is the opening into the kitchen with and without the peninsula? I really think the peninsula is just going to be a thing to walk around but obvs up to you. A wide opening is so great into a kitchen. The first time you have 3+ people in there you will be so happy. I think where the bathroom is now, you get a very narrow living room that looks like a hallway and will be difficult to decorate (remember you've got to leave room for the doors to swing and for humans to move to in front of the open door), and a very awkward situation if people are in the living room and someone goes to the bathroom. If they're opposite the stairs, you have a kind of logical hallway area for the stairs, coat closet and powder room and a full width living room oriented towards a blank wall you can build out. That room wouldn't get much light from the front of the building anyway imo. In fact, is there a way you can sneak a solar tube through the master closet/bathroom down into the living room? It would eat some space but I'd consider it if you like them. I love the dining room up front fwiw, but I would definitely try to sneak in a kitchen table if at all possible or maybe a small game table in the living room that you could use for a quick bite.
